    The ANA (American Numismatic Association) has a dealer search page: Money.org | ANA Dealer Directory You can search for a dealer through that page. You'll, of course, still have to pay the grading fees (and what ever the dealer charges you for shipping, ect...).

    *I'll add, since you want to go through PCGS, if you find a dealer in your area, call first and make sure they submit coins to PCGS. TopCat's link to PCGS dealers is a good source too.
